10

8

6

4

2


8.1

7.8

6.9

8.0

6.4

9.1

6.0

7.7

5.5

7.9

5.5
0.0

9 Command-line Argument Parsers libraries and projects

  • picocli

    8.1 7.8 Java
    Picocli is a modern framework for building powerful, user-friendly, GraalVM-enabled command line apps with ease. It supports colors, autocompletion, subcommands, and more. In 1 source file so apps can include as source & avoid adding a dependency. Written in Java, usable from Groovy, Kotlin, Scala, etc.
  • JCommander

    6.9 8.0 L2 Java
    Command line parsing framework for Java
  • Revolutionize your code reviews with AI. CodeRabbit offers PR summaries, code walkthroughs, 1-click suggestions, and AST-based analysis. Boost productivity and code quality across all major languages with each PR.
    Promo coderabbit.ai
    CodeRabbit Logo
  • JLine

    6.4 9.1 Java
    JLine is a Java library for handling console input.
  • Spring Shell 3

    6.0 7.7 Java
    Spring based shell
  • args4j

    5.5 7.9 L4 Java
    args4j
  • Airline

    5.5 0.0 L3 Java
    Java annotation-based framework for parsing Git like command line structures
  • JOpt Simple

    4.1 3.3 L5 Java
    Java library for parsing command line options
  • Airline 2

    2.9 6.5 Java
    Java annotation-based framework for parsing Git like command line structures with deep extensibility
  • JewelCLI

    2.5 0.0 L5 Java
    JewelCli uses an annotated interface definition to automatically parse and present command line arguments

Add another 'Command-line Argument Parsers' Library